Draft at the source courtesy of GenDV138 just prior to his disappearance - thanks (for the beer, not for disappearing)! Clear golden color. Aroma of light pepper flesh. Taste has fruit and mild pepper heat. Subtle.

16 oz pour on draft at Caboose. Slightly hazy golden orange with off-white head. Aromas of citrus, floral, subtle peppers. Tastes of peppers, floral, citrus. Medium body with a dry and slightly warm finish. Peppery tingle on the tongue.

Draft at Novemberfest 2015. Poured a pale yellow color with a small off-white head. Aroma was light malt, some touch of light floral hops with a touch of pepper skins. Flavor was slow pepper, with a light ghost pepper heat that sneaks up but isnβt awfully hot.
